9/11 memories based on birthyear
#1
I've recently seen some discussions about 9/11 being the start of the 4T and people remembering it. What do you think about this take on it? These are just estimates, so please don't take this as gospel.

Born 1987 and earlier: Nearly all/all Americans, Canadians, and Western Europeans born during and before 1987 will have very vivid memories and know the political significance and impact of 9/11.

Born 1988-1990: Nearly all/all Americans, Canadians, and Western Europeans born in 1988-1990 will remember the event vividly, but they will perceive the political significance and impact of 9/11 with a middle schooler's point of view rather than that of a high schooler's.

Born 1991-1993: Most Americans, Canadians, and Western Europeans born in 1991-1993 will remember the event vividly, but it's unlikely for them to understand the effects that 9/11 had on American and world politics.

Born 1994-1996: Many Americans and Canadians will still remember the event, given that they were the last to be at elementary school when 9/11 happened. However, they most certainly won't understand the impact of 9/11 and at most may have seen it as "bad people did something bad to America". The only way how these people can get affected by 9/11 is if they had a family member that died during the event.

Born 1997-1999: It's unlikely for Americans and Canadians born during these years to remember 9/11. Even if they were to remember 9/11, their memories are most likely vague at best (probably not really the case for 1997, especially if they were born early that year and lived in an urban area). I get that adding 1999 (and possibly even late 1998) can be stretching it, but I've heard cases where people born then can remember 9/11 even though it's very rare. Many people born during these years may have memories from 2001, but most probably won't remember 9/11, especially if they lived outside of an American urban area.

Born 2000-2001: By this point it's impossible for people born in these years to remember 9/11. However, some may vaguely remember the changes that took place because of 9/11 in the few years after.

Born 2002 and later: Not alive when 9/11 happened.
